Trump–Putin summit: expert explains when it could take place

Trump-Putin Meeting in Alaska

Political expert and serviceman Oleksandr Musiienko explained that it is not worth counting on a Trump–Putin meeting or a ceasefire for now, and that the United States is generally shifting its focus to China and Venezuela, Politeka reports.
He spoke about this on his blog.

As U.S. Secretary of State Rubio stated, the expert notes, Trump will agree to another meeting with Putin only if there is a significant opportunity to end the Russian–Ukrainian war, and there will be no meetings just for the sake of meetings.

“In other words, in the near future a Trump–Putin summit will not take place, because Russia continues offensive actions, continues terrorist strikes on our civilian facilities, and for now they believe they can break our resistance. And the U.S. is also waiting until Russia is ready to agree to a ceasefire,” Oleksandr Musiienko asserts.

Meanwhile, he says, the U.S. is becoming increasingly involved in the situation in Latin America: War Minister Hegseth announced the start of a military operation against the Venezuelan drug cartels. According to the expert, we will see how large-scale and long-lasting this operation will be, but it will certainly shift the focus away from the Russian–Ukrainian war. In addition, he adds, Hegseth proposed a strategic redistribution of global security responsibilities so that the U.S. reduces its presence in Europe and concentrates on deterring China in the Indo-Pacific region, while Europe itself would handle deterring Russia on NATO’s eastern flank, since, he says, Europe has sufficient potential for this.

“Well, it seems the U.S. will be weakening its presence and attention in Europe. Therefore, the tasks for European countries are doubling and tripling. They need to build up their own capabilities, invest more in defense and security, because the war is already reaching EU countries — drones are already flying in the skies above EU member states. The war is closer than they think. And they must act, unite around Ukraine, support Ukraine, and develop their own capabilities. This is truly important,” Oleksandr Musiienko concludes.
